Person with army weapons arrested

Pistol and ammunition seized

Hyderabad, May 26, 2006

The Central Zone Task Force on Friday arrested a deserter of the Indian Army and seized a sophisticated pistol and ammunition from his possession. One, K.Pulla Reddy, a jawan in the Army procured the weapons from his friend who is also working in Army. He was caught with the pistol and 21 live rounds of 7.65mm bullets while he was trying to sell them at Old MLA quarters on Friday.

Task Force DCP G.Sudheer Babu said that the accused was in the army and was absent for the last couple of months. He was debt ridden and left with no option except to sell the same. The police also recovered some Army letter heads and a mobile phone.
